Research Data

Chemical & Structural Identifiers

Chemical Name (IUPAC)
N-acetyl-L-α-glutamyl-L-α-glutamyl-L-methionyl-L-glutaminyl-L-arginyl-L-arginyl-L-alanyl-L-aspartamide ((2S)-2-[[(2S)-2-[[(2S)-5-amino-2-[[(2S)-5-carbamimidamido-2-[[(2S)-5-carbamimidamido-2-[[(2S)-4-carbamoyl-2-[[(2S)-2-[[(2S)-2-acetamido-4-carboxybutanoyl]amino]-4-carboxybutanoyl]amino]-4-methylsulfanylbutanoyl]amino]pentanoyl]amino]pentanoyl]amino]propanoyl]amino]-4-amino-4-oxobutanoic acid)
CAS Registry Number
868844-74-0
PubChem CID
16133827
Molecular Formula
C41H70N16O16S
Molecular Weight
1074.48 Da (1075.16 g/mol average)
Sequence
Ac-Glu-Glu-Met-Gln-Arg-Arg-Ala-Asp-NH2 (Single-letter: Ac-EEMQRRAD-NH2)
SMILES
CC(=O)N[C@@H](CCC(=O)O)C(=O)N[C@@H](CCC(=O)O)C(=O)N[C@@H](CCSC)C(=O)N[C@@H](CCC(=O)N)C(=O)N[C@@H](CCCNC(=N)N)C(=O)N[C@@H](CCCNC(=N)N)C(=O)N[C@@H](C)C(=O)N[C@@H](CC(=O)O)C(=O)N
InChIKey
UBFGGOMVQLKTSW-NNAZSAHJSA-N
Salt / Counter-Ion
Supplied as a high-purity lyophilized acetate (CH3COO-) or trifluoroacetate (CF3COO-) salt.
Synonyms
SNAP-8, Snap-8, Acetyl Octapeptide-3, Acetyl Octapeptide-1, Acetyl Glutamyl Heptapeptide-3, Octapeptide-3, Ac-Glu-Glu-Met-Gln-Arg-Arg-Ala-Asp-NH2

Handling & Stability

Storage. Store dry solid desiccated at -20°C to -80°C, protected from atmospheric moisture and direct light.

Solubility. Highly hydrophilic; freely soluble in sterile laboratory-grade deionized water (≥ 20 mg/mL) and sterile Phosphate-Buffered Saline (PBS, pH 7.4, ≥ 15 mg/mL) for in vitro assay application.

  • Methionine Oxidation & Handling: Contains an internal methionine residue (Met3) susceptible to sulfoxide oxidation under aerobic conditions; prepare working solutions using degassed buffers, avoid strong oxidizers or excessive vortexing, and store single-use aliquots at -20°C to eliminate degradation from repeated freeze-thaw cycles.

Mechanism & Literature

Synthetic biomimetic octapeptide engineered as an elongated analogue of the N-terminal domain of SNAP-25 (Synaptosomal-Associated Protein 25). Functions as a competitive inhibitor of SNARE (Soluble N-ethylmaleimide-sensitive factor Attachment protein REceptor) complex assembly.

SNARE Complex Destabilization Kinetics: Evaluated in cell-free biochemical assays and chromaffin/neuronal cell cultures:

Structural Distinction from Argireline: An extension of the hexapeptide Argireline (Ac-EEMQRR-NH2) by two additional C-terminal residues (Ala7-Asp8). This elongation enhances steric hindrance within the SNARE bundle, providing increased potency in cellular catecholamine and acetylcholine release inhibition assays.

Technical Laboratory FAQs

What structural difference distinguishes SNAP-8 from Argireline in vitro?

SNAP-8 (Ac-EEMQRRAD-NH2) is an octapeptide containing two additional amino acids (Ala7-Asp8) at the C-terminus compared to the hexapeptide Argireline (Ac-EEMQRR-NH2), providing greater conformational stability and steric inhibition of SNARE complex formation in biochemical assays.

How does SNAP-8 disrupt vesicular neurotransmitter release in cell culture models?

SNAP-8 mimics the N-terminal domain of SNAP-25, competing for incorporation into the ternary SNARE complex with syntaxin and synaptobrevin. This destabilizes the coiled-coil core complex, blocking vesicle fusion and preventing calcium-triggered exocytosis of acetylcholine.

What reconstitution vehicle is recommended for preparing in vitro SNAP-8 working stocks?

Sterile deionized water or sterile PBS (pH 7.4) provides rapid dissolution at concentrations ≥ 15 mg/mL. Preparing working stocks with degassed buffers protects the Met3 thioether group against air oxidation during long-term experimental series.
